Output d4c102877de6ee35e13615c779944f4e4fa253bb30889f643302690801f96328:1

value
3087539
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 818a2ec51b180d7729e036a7c5cb267fefb6b1bd OP_EQUALVERIFY OP_CHECKSIG
address
1CowhrC17E4W7DGNKhwAc7xb8WTzRkrXNE
transaction
d4c102877de6ee35e13615c779944f4e4fa253bb30889f643302690801f96328
spent
true